The HUMAIN_ONE Interface
Humain_One embodies an ultra-compact, non-invasive, and scalable sensor system that integrates seamlessly into different applications, even into smartwatches, for fast and accurate motion tracking up to continuous finger motions.
The developed sensor system is extremely compact, provides ready-to-use digital output with very high signal to noise ratio, and does not require complicated analysis electronics.
Humain_One’s measurement principle allows for extreme flexibility in terms of a small form factor, yet is very simple to manufacture.

Lower limb prostheses
Humain_One's 3D-sensor arrays mea-sure the skin deformations resulting from the users’ movements.
Application scenarios are not limited to the wrist or forearm. Also lower limb applications are possible. The broad patent strategy covers the application on any extremity.

Humain_One is the world’s most compact, wrist-worn, non-invasive wearable for real-time gesture and continuous finger motion prediction suitable for daily use.
The core technology is an innovative, patented standalone sensor system with ultra-low power consumption and in-place signal processing.
The very thin sensor system can be independently implemented into various form factors at various scales. A device integration e.g. into a smartwatch housing is effectively possible.
Its simplicity and robustness make it cost-effectively available. The components are manufactured by established 3rd party companies for shortest time to market in nearly every industrial area and usage scenario.
On the software side, Humain_One comes with associated libraries, dependencies, and ready-to use programs for the development of specific applications (Python, C++, robot operating system (ROS)). Specifically, deep neural network models for gesture and motion prediction are provided.
